Restoring settings after generic reimage
This task assumes that you have saved settings using
ssave.bat
before reimaging the K2 Summit
3G system, and that the reimage (Acronis) process is complete.
1. If you have not already done so, start up the K2 Summit 3G system and log on with administrator
privileges.
The administrator password is
adminGV!
.
2. Connect the USB Recovery Flash Drive to a USB port on the K2 Summit 3G system.
3. From the USB Recovery Flash Drive, run the following and wait for the process to complete:
Tools\SaveRestoreScripts\srestore.bat
Next, do the following as appropriate to restore your K2 Summit 3G system. Refer to related topics
in this document or as otherwise indicated.
1. Restore network configuration. If you saved settings with
ssave.bat
, refer to
C:\ipconfig.txt
for the complete listing of the network settings that the K2 Summit 3G system had before
reimaging.
2. Install the SiteConfig Discovery Agent.
3. If you install software with SiteConfig, do the following:
•
Take Embedded Security out of Update mode.
•
Install SNFS software and K2 software using SiteConfig.
•
Restore SabreTooth licenses.
